#be38f0 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#be38f0 is composed of 74.5% red, 22% green and 94.1%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 20.8% cyan, 76.7% magenta, 0% yellow and 5.9% black. It has a hue angle of 283.7 degrees, a saturation of 86% and a lightness of 58%. #be38f0 color hex could be obtained by blending #ff70ff with #7d00e1. Closest websafe color is: #cc33ff.

#be38f0 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#be38f0 has RGB values of R:190, G:56, B:240 and CMYK values of C:0.21, M:0.77, Y:0, K:0.06. Its decimal value is 12466416.
